The size of Clyde is approximately 40.2 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 0.2% of total area. The population of Clyde in 2016 was 2117 people. By 2021 the population was 11177 showing a population growth of 428.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clyde is 30-39 years. Households in Clyde are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clyde work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.80% of the homes in Clyde were owner-occupied compared with 73.40% in 2016.
